As you may already know, Pay-Per-Click advertising ain't what it used to be. A saturated marketplace,sky-high keyword costs and rampant click fraud have all turned what was once the single fastest method to generate web traffic into the single quickest way to decimate you advertising budget. As any smallbusiness owner knows, once your advertising budget is gone, your finished, plain and simple. Popular PPC engines like Google, Overture, Miva, ect. claim no responsibility for fraudulent clicks, yet, they can precisely monitor programs like Google Adsense to ensure publishers aren't doing the same. Curious. Yes there are a variety of services of which you may enlist to keep an inventory of your clicks, but these services are only effective if an advertiser has html access to their web site, leaving the affiliate marketer out in the cold.
